Circular RNA and its mechanisms in diabetic retinopathy: a systematic review

<h4>ABSTRACT</h4> Circular RNAs (CircRNAs) are endogenous long non-coding RNAs. Unlike linear RNAs, they are structurally continuous and covalently closed, without 5 ’caps or 3’ polyadenylation tails. High-throughput RNA sequencing has enabled people to find several endogenous circRNAs in different species and tissues. circRNA mainly acts as a sponge for microRNAs in cytoplasm to regulates protein translation, or...
